My account has been deleted because i joined another Dropbox team by mistake.

hello

I have an account for several years and this morning i joined by mistake (thought if was a shared folder) another existing account so my own personnal account is terminated.

This is a catastophy, could you please help me?

I would like to have my personnal account back and leave the other one but i can't do that because i am not the administrator

    cognedur wrote:

    I would like to have my personnal account back and leave the other one but i can't do that because i am not the administrator


    You need to contact the team admin and ask them to convert your account back to an individual account. It's very important that they don't just remove you from the team as doing so would delete your account. If that were to happen they only have seven days to restore your account. They must convert it back to an individual account.
